What is an intelligence major?

Intelligence programs focus on the principles and techniques of intelligence acquisition, analysis and exploitation. Includes instruction in intelligence organizations, the intelligence cycle, intelligence operations planning, intelligence analysis and reporting, intelligence methods, electronic and signals intelligence, operations and communications security, human intelligence management, intelligence chain of command, information exploitation and psychological warfare, and the relationship to national security policy and strategy.

How popular is intelligence as a major?

Each year, around 640 students obtain a bachelor’s degree and around 830 students obtain an associate degree in intelligence. In 2021, 1,260 students received a bachelor's degree and 902 students received an associate degree. This is 23% more intelligence majors than there were in 2020. Intelligence is a relatively popular major compared to other protective services majors.
